After I had the drywall replaced for the holes cut to replace the water pipes I contacted Buhrle Plumbing again. Mr. Buhrle had already been paid for the work and he still came out within a week and reinstalled the utility sink. I watched him replace it and noticed he brought in his own screws and was cutting them with a handsaw so they would fit. I was curious why he hadn't used the original screws, so I asked him. He told me the original screws were galvanized steel and since they were located in concrete beneath a sink he was replacing them with stainless steel screws so I wouldn't have to worry about rust.
